93BlackBird 03-24-2003, 05:05 PM ok well I haven't done my axles yet, but its been bothering me so I did some reasearch since it slowed down towards the end of the day today
Both axles for both cars(P10) and (B13) have the same inner shaft spline counts
g20 has a 27 spline outer
SE-R has a 25 spline outer
Since the g20 tranny is going to the SE-R you don't need to swap inner splines as long as the diam. of the shaft is the same(which I will try to find out tomorrow)
Looks like the next mystery to solve(if its a mystery at all) is the axle length. I wish my memory was good, but it seriously sucks
